Godfrey Oboabona Hopes Rizespor Will Go Far In Turkish Cup
Published: September 23, 2014
Rizespor defender Godfrey Oboabona is inching closer to earning himself a starting shirt for the clash with Bursaspor this weekend after scoring in the second round of the Turkish Cup tie against Tekirda�spor on Tuesday afternoon.
The Nigeria international opened scoring for Rizespor in the 16th minute, as the Super Lig side thrashed part-timers Tekirda�spor 5 - 1.
Speaking to allnigeriasoccer.com immediately after the tie, Oboabona has stated that Rizespor made sure their opportunities were converted, which proved the difference.
“It was not an easy game, it is just that we took our chances. I scored through a header from a corner kick. I thank God the game went well, and I want to thank God for this victory.
“This is just the beginning of the competition and I pray we go far, ” Godfrey Oboabona told allnigeriasoccer.com.
The former Sunshine Stars skipper has notched up four goals in all competitions since his switch to Turkey in the summer of 2013.
